In a large skillet, cook beef and onion over medium heat until meat is no longer pink; crumble meat; drain. Transfer to a 3-qt. slow cooker. Stir in the celery, Chinese vegetables, gravy mix and soy sauce. Cover and cook on low until celery is tender, 4-6 hours, stirring occasionally. Serve with noodles.

WebFeb 17, 2024 · If you need the sauce to be gluten-free, use Tamari sauce. Sesame Oil: Sesame oil brings big authentic Chinese flavor to a stir fry sauce. Brown Sugar: Brown sugar balances out the salty, bitter soy sauce and acidity from the wine, plus contributes great flavor. It makes a big difference, so don’t skip it.
